Most often, a child’s community school is considered to be the first and most preferable educational setting. In some situations, a child's family and school learning team may decide that a referral to a Special Program or Unique Setting is in their best interest. Consideration for placement in a Special Program or Unique Setting is a collaborative process that requires careful consideration based on specific and detailed supporting documentation. As our school is a Unique Setting within the Calgary Board of Education, parents or guardians are not able to register their child for Christine Meikle School independently of this collaborative process. Please contact your child's current school administrators or learning support team to discuss the steps that can be taken to ensure your child thrives in their learning.
